Algiers, Algeria – The Algerian Academy of Science and Technology hosted a symposium in Algiers on Thursday dedicated to the critical issue of scientific integrity. The event, held on December 4, 2025, brought together leading researchers, academics, and policymakers to discuss strategies for upholding ethical standards in scientific research.
The symposium centered on the importance of integrity in all stages of the research process, from data collection and analysis to publication and dissemination. Participants examined the challenges to maintaining scientific integrity and explored practical measures to promote ethical conduct within the scientific community.
A key focus of the discussions was the implementation of procedures designed to foster ethical behavior within the scientific sphere. Speakers highlighted the need for clear guidelines and robust oversight mechanisms to prevent misconduct, such as plagiarism, data fabrication, and conflicts of interest.
The academy emphasized its commitment to fostering a culture of integrity and accountability within the Algerian scientific community. By providing a platform for dialogue and collaboration, the symposium aimed to strengthen ethical practices and promote responsible research conduct across all disciplines.
The event served as a crucial step in reinforcing the importance of ethical considerations in scientific advancement and ensuring the credibility and trustworthiness of research conducted in Algeria.
